BRIEFING — Leadership Review: Customer Concentration

For heads of department: Pellmore Fabrication now derives 46% of revenue from a single client, Ashgrove Rail, up from 31% last year. Contract renewal falls due in eleven months, and procurement signals from Ashgrove are mixed. Finance has modelled downside scenarios; Operations has flagged capacity we could redirect. Departments should identify dependencies on this account by month-end. The proposed mitigation path is summarised below.

confidential, bahof-yaweg: Headcount on the Kaseth team goes from 32 to 109 by the end of January. Gross margin on Kaseth came in at 46 percent against a plan of 45 percent.

## Audit Item 14 — Experiment Assignment Service

Verify the Brambleworth assignment service: deterministic bucketing per user, no reassignment mid-experiment, and exclusion groups enforced at allocation time. Pull last 30 days of assignment logs, confirm hash-salt rotation did not occur during any live experiment, and check that holdout traffic never exceeds the configured ceiling. Flag any variant exposure before consent capture. Record findings in the audit tracker. Any discrepancy must be escalated directly to the service owner named below.

named custodian: Brivan Eliath Quenox Frador

## Changelog — Ticktrace 1.9

### Renamed: DRIFT_API_TOKEN
During the cron drift investigation we found plugins confusing this variable with the metrics token, so it has been renamed to indicate it authorizes drift-report uploads specifically. Plugin authors must read the new name from 1.9 onward; the old name is ignored without warning. Sample env files in the SDK are updated. In your deployment env file, the drift-report upload secret is set on the next line.

env line for fawef-taguf: VAULT_KEY13=a9695905a9a90

Leadership review: Vellmark Tools pricing. The Arden line trails competitors by 8–12% on list price with no volume uplift. Margin erosion worsened after the Q2 input-cost spike. Recommendation: raise Arden base prices 6% and retire the legacy discount tiers by quarter end. Delay risks anchoring customers to unsustainable rates. Full modeling is attached. The confidential planning note follows below.

management briefing: Only 5 of the 80 pilot accounts renewed Zorix, so a churn review is set for October 1.